Trenton Chapter Registers Barrolle For CAF!

The Trenton Chapter of Mighty Barrolle based in the United States of America has ended speculations regarding the registration of the Liberia Football Association (LFA) 2009 premiership champions for the Confederation of African Football (CAF) champions league.

In an interview with this paper, the president of Mighty barrolle, Mr. Garmondeh Karnga confirmed that the Trenton Chapter of the Rollers has sent the money for the registration which according to him, has already been done.

There were widespread speculations that Barrolle will not participate in the CAF champions league due to financial constrains, but the speculations are now over with the latest that the team has registered.

Mr. Karnga has also hailed the Trenton Chapter of Mighty Barrolle for its continuous support to the team.

He noted that the Chapter has always come to the call of the team even at the last minute.

He also told this paper that the Trenton Chapter, headed by Mr. Moses W. Tarr, Mr. D. Zeogar Wilson and others, gave support to the Rollers which made it easy for the team to clinch the LFA 2009 premiership title.

“The Trenton Chapter is in fact, the strongest Chapter of Mighty Barrolle.

“We want to commend the Chapter for its continuous support for Mighty Barrolle with the latest being the registration for the CAF competition.

“We can assure officials of the Chapter that the Rollers will bring pride again in such stiff competition,” Barrolle boss averred.
